Output dd8fb8fd404917d86f0ceccd6767ae2d01008dcd0aa8589a65197b50a3f8d714:4

value
35383563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0589ef316704d29212ebd0e38475c71ff3adf6 OP_EQUAL
address
MAGkSG5UxJQkgC1tsfiUYfHbGWapddZ9D4
transaction
dd8fb8fd404917d86f0ceccd6767ae2d01008dcd0aa8589a65197b50a3f8d714
spent
true